A Ninawa criminal court judge was killed and his driver was wounded late Sunday (July 1st) when gunmen fired on his car in Mosul, Iraqi police said Monday.
"Gunmen believed to be from al-Qaeda attacked Judge Abdul Latif Mohammed while he was on his way home in the al-Zohour neighbourhood using silencer-equipped weapons, killing him immediately and seriously injuring his driver," said Col. Khalid al-Hamdani, the Ninawa police spokesperson.
"A few hours after the attack, the police arrested seven suspects in the incident," al-Hamdani said. "They are now under investigation."
